AA Meetings in Canton, Ohio
Canton AA meetings give a warm welcome to anyone in the area who needs help overcoming a drinking problem. The meetings across the city are open to people of all ages, backgrounds, and religions. During an AA meeting in Canton, attendees work on the principles of the ’12 steps’, which were developed to remove the temptation to drink and show attendees that they can live a fulfilling, alcohol-free life. AA meetings in Canton are available throughout the city, offering a supportive environment for local residents to open about their struggles with alcoholism.
By using peer support, Alcoholics Anonymous meetings in Canton aim to provide encouragement to those in need of help to undergo treatment for their drinking problem. These meetings are also there to support people who have completed rehab and are looking to build on the skills they established in treatment. Finding AA Meeting Near Me
All of the AA meetings across Canton will have a unique topic, mood, and tone, and these factors often depend on the location of the meeting and who is leading it. If you have access to the internet and do a search for “AA meetings near me,” you are likely to come across Canton AA meetings taking place in community centers, churches, and peoples’ homes.
- Will the meeting be co-ed?
- Is the group solely for people with drinking problems?
- What is the meeting location?
- Who is leading the group and what can I expect?
- How big will the group be?
- Do people smoke at the meetings?
The answers to these questions should provide you with an understanding of the meetings near you. On top of this, if you have the time to sit in on a few meetings, this can really help you get a feel for the group leader and the tone of a meeting. You can also check out the Alcoholics Anonymous website for information on AA meetings in the Canton area.

NA Meetings in Canton, Ohio
Since 1953, Narcotics Anonymous (NA) have been offering support to people battling drug addiction. Narcotics Anonymous (NA) is also a 12-step organization and is open to people from all backgrounds and walks of life. NA meetings in Canton are held on a weekly basis at locations like community centers, churches, libraries, and parks.
In Narcotics Anonymous meetings, attendees encourage each other to stay on track in their quest to overcome a drug addiction. To help attendees deal with narcotics addiction, the Canton NA meetings take the principles from AA meetings and relate them to each person’s battle with drugs. Under the guidance of a group leader, members work on improving their honesty, willingness to change, and open-mindedness.
By working on these key principles among peers in recovery, members are given a strong foundation to achieve the best possible recovery from a drug addiction. Just like the AA meetings held in the city, all of the NA meetings in Canton are free of charge, easy to locate, and open to all.
